Words from Joe "The Fish"

Shit happens to everyone. Lately it happened to me, as you all know. Not something I'd want to go through again, but those are the risks we take to be able to ride a motorcycle, and I'm sure most of you have this same passion for two wheels. The out pour of support that I received is unreal. It shows not only your passion for riding but your LOVE for your fellow rider, and it is something that made me go all mushy inside to say the least. It will not be forgotten by me or my family. I have to take time to mend up and I'm awaiting a couple more surgeries, but I am optimistic about being back in the shop and on the road as soon as I can. Gotta put my projects on hold in the mean time...just when I was making progress on the chevy. Damn.

Brian has said thanks to everyone that has had a hand in my support but I want to dually thank all of you! Everyone who bought a shirt, donated money or goodies, or just sent a concerned or get well email, I want you to know I am more grateful than I can express and we are working on something special for you. Mike Clarke, Joe Zito, and the FOTS and Philly boys for putting together something serious and all of your time and hard work. Tim and the Death Science guys. My brothers here in Boston as well as Jermiah, Max, and Wil on the other side of the country and everyone else who posted on their blog for spreading the word. My boys in Texas and everyone else who has had a hand in this. Thanks to all of you.

Joe "The Fish" Cano
